    First impression on the Jelly Bean update

    The first thing that hits you when you when you enter Jelly Bean is the beautiful (and functional) welcome screen. To the left weather information is now included and from the unlock area you can now do the following:

    1.)Unlock and enter UI
    2.)Launch video player
    3.)Launch the all new "Google Now"
    4.)Jump into picture albums
    5.)Start camera
    6.)Launch music player
    7.)Launch SmartQ Reader
    8.)Launch Google Maps

    Smooooothness

    As a part of the Jelly Bean update navigation and transitions in the UI are very very smooth. I have never tried an Android device with this kind of smoothness before. Programs are now sliding in from the corner (though fast) giving switching from one app to the next more of a flow.
    Smoothness during web browsing is also massivly improved. There is no lag what so ever sliding through sites and zooming in and out is lightning fast. I do not know how this update will effect gaming as I do very little gaming. But Im sure someone will give feedback on this area in the near future.

    All in all, Im VERY happy with this update, which clearly brings out the best of the T30. As it is getting late here in Norway I have to get some sleep, but tomorrow I will try some light battery testing
